MaterialA snap type Onesize PUL (Polyurethane laminate) pocket diaper. I love this PUL pocket diaper for its softness... it's just like wearing clothes. I swear!
Outer layer: PUL for waterproofness with prints and colours
Inner layer: coloured microfleece
Lasting?Expect it to function like any other PUL pocket diaper. Since it is so soft, the PUL layer is thinner. I had encountered dampness on the pocket diaper itself especially around the inner leg casing if my heavywetter wears it more than 2-3 hours, depending on her fluid output too.
Shape & FitIt is not a very well-shaped diaper as this is the only pocket diaper than will drop and reveal the buttock when my dd runs and plays! I received feedback from my friend who is using on her 1 months old baby boy (who is more than 5kg now) that the fit is not the best too.
Still haven't figure out the reason why it is so... probably the waist is not well snug even I fasten on tighter snap. But you can't snap too tight as it won't be comfortable on the child.
Another thing that I suspect - the heavy insert? (actually is the insert that is full of urine)... more likely this is another factor and therefore have to change them often. Any yet, I still have dropping diaper until my dd got herself out from it bottomless! LOL!
The room for insert is very spacious and I need to press out the extra air in there otherwise... you will feel like the diaper is so... you name it.
One more thing, the snap is difficult to snap on compare to other snap diaper. It took me longer time to wear this one.
TIPS: Try to snap first before wearing on baby like wearing a pant. It works for wriggle little one but still I don't prefer this method as it won't be in place properly either. I have to adjust and readjust... but you can try this tip on your wriggle baby and update me.
PRO:1) Onesize diaper
2) Quick drying
3) The softest PUL pocket diaper that I have
4) Very easy to use... stuff, wear and go!
CON:1) Outer layer will be damp or sometimes wet depends on the wetting
2) The shape and the fit is not that good compare with other pocket diaper
3) No top stitch at the back of the diaper, abit messy (Happy Heiny's pocket diaper is another diaper without top stitch)
It is worth to try for bumwear as the issue on the fit is also because of different built from one baby to the other. Only if they can replace the snap with a better type, I think it will be a very popular pocket diaper too.
